Jonesville, NC

Yadkin County, North Carolina

Latitude: 36.235589     Longitude: -80.842233
Population 2,276 (2005)
Elevation of Jonesville, North Carolina: 913 feet



General Economic Characteristics, 2000 data (id:3734840, place: Jonesville town, North Carolina)

EMPLOYMENT STATUS
Population 16 years and over: 1,157 (100%)
In labor force: 675 (58.34%)
--Civilian labor force: 675 (58.34%)
----Employed: 635 (54.88%)
----Unemployed: 40 (3.46%)
------Percent of civilian labor force: 5.9%
--Armed Forces: 0 (0%)
Not in labor force: 482 (41.66%)
Females 16 years and over: 658 (56.87%)
In labor force: 339 (29.3%)
--Civilian labor force: 339 (29.3%)
----Employed: 321 (27.74%)
Own children under 6 years: 111 (9.59%)
All parents in family in labor force: 78 (6.74%)

COMMUTING TO WORK
Workers 16 years and over: 627 (100%)
Car, truck, or van - - drove alone: 503 (80.22%)
Car, truck, or van - - carpooled: 97 (15.47%)
Public transportation (including taxicab): 2 (0.32%)
Walked: 4 (0.64%)
Other means: 10 (1.59%)
Worked at home: 11 (1.75%)
Mean travel time to work: 20.9 minutes

OCCUPATION
Employed civilian population 16 years and over: 635 (100%)
Management, professional, and related occupations: 150 (23.62%)
Service occupations: 112 (17.64%)
Sales and office occupations: 158 (24.88%)
Farming, fishing, and forestry occupations.: 0 (0%)
Construction, extraction, and maintenance occupations: 59 (9.29%)
Production, transportation, and material moving occupations: 156 (24.57%)

INDUSTRY
Agriculture, forestry, fishing and hunting, and mining: 0 (0%)
Construction: 42 (6.61%)
Manufacturing: 191 (30.08%)
Wholesale trade.: 18 (2.83%)
Retail trade: 70 (11.02%)
Transportation and warehousing, and utilities: 18 (2.83%)
Information: 16 (2.52%)
Finance, insurance, real estate, and rental and leasing: 23 (3.62%)
Professional, scientific, management, administrative, and waste management services: 32 (5.04%)
Educational, health and social services: 108 (17.01%)
Arts, entertainment, recreation, accommodation and food services: 75 (11.81%)
Other services (except public administration): 23 (3.62%)
Public administration: 19 (2.99%)

CLASS OF WORKER
Private wage and salary workers: 531 (83.62%)
Government workers: 74 (11.65%)
Self-employed workers in own not incorporated business: 23 (3.62%)
Unpaid family workers: 7 (1.1%)

INCOME IN 1999
Households: 690 (100%)
Less than $10,000: 111 (16.09%)
$10,000 to $14,999: 70 (10.14%)
$15,000 to $24,999: 159 (23.04%)
$25,000 to $34,999: 110 (15.94%)
$35,000 to $49,999: 110 (15.94%)
$50,000 to $74,999: 78 (11.3%)
$75,000 to $99,999: 27 (3.91%)
$100,000 to $149,999: 15 (2.17%)
$150,000 to $199,999: 4 (0.58%)
$200,000 or more: 6 (0.87%)
Median household income: $25,543

With earnings: 487 (70.58%)
--Mean earnings: $33,847
With Social Security income: 249 (36.09%)
--Mean Social Security income: $9,697
With Supplemental Security Income: 35 (5.07%)
--Mean Supplemental Security Income: $4,923
With public assistance income: 31 (4.49%)
--Mean public assistance income: $2,180
With retirement income: 117 (16.96%)
--Mean retirement income: $35,321

Families: 416 (100%)
Less than $10,000: 33 (7.93%)
$10,000 to $14,999: 44 (10.58%)
$15,000 to $24,999: 89 (21.39%)
$25,000 to $34,999: 67 (16.11%)
$35,000 to $49,999: 79 (18.99%)
$50,000 to $74,999: 59 (14.18%)
$75,000 to $99,999: 20 (4.81%)
$100,000 to $149,999: 15 (3.61%)
$150,000 to $199,999: 4 (0.96%)
$200,000 or more: 6 (1.44%)
Median family income: $31,400

Per capita income: $16,528

Median earnings (dollars)
Male full-time, year-round workers: $26,200
Female full-time, year-round workers: $20,242

POVERTY STATUS IN 1999
Families: 61 (14.66%)
--With related children under 18 years: 48 (11.54%)
----With related children under 5 years: 20 (4.81%)
Families with female householder, no husband present: 39 (9.38%)
--With related children under 18 years: 30 (7.21%)
----With related children under 5 years: 15 (3.61%)
Individuals: 255 (61.3%)
--18 years and over: 178 (42.79%)
----65 years and over: 49 (11.78%)
--Related children under 18 years: 77 (18.51%)
----Related children 5 to 17 years: 46 (11.06%)
--Unrelated individuals 15 years and over: 74 (17.79%)
